Fixes #308: Update rack assignment for all child devices when moving a parent device

This commit is contained in:
Jeremy Stretch 2016-07-15 16:05:21 -04:00
parent 518af1b95c
commit 534e6ac19e

View File

@ -681,6 +681,9 @@ class Device(CreatedUpdatedModel):
self.device_type.device_bay_templates.all()]
)
# Update Rack assignment for any child Devices
Device.objects.filter(parent_bay__device=self).update(rack=self.rack)
def to_csv(self):
return ','.join([
self.name or '',